Phrasal verbs:

A phrasal verb is a verb that is made up of a main verb together with an adverb or a preposition, or both. Un verbo compuesto es un verbo que se compone de un verbo principal junto con un adverbio o una preposición, o ambos.

Grammar: Algunos phrasal verbs se pueden separar, son llamados “separable phasal verbs”, ejemplo: Put away your toys, please.

Put your toys away, please.

Ex. Take apart: Yesterday I took apart my vacuum cleaner.

Yesterday I took my vacuum cleaner apart.
